Section 153: Rules relating to open space regulation of Building where Block allotment is made

The West Bengal Municipal (Building) Rules, 2007State Rules of West Bengal · 1993

(1) Residential:

(a) Front Space 2.00 meters fixed;

(b) Side Space 1.20 meters minimum on narrower side and 3.70 meters minimum on wider side;

(c) Back Space 7.00 metres minimum.

Note.—Covered area shall not exceed 40% of the gross area.

(2) Any plot of 4 K or above for all other categories of buildings eg. Office/Hospital, Institutional, Commercial, Business, Assembly, Mercantile, Industrial, Storage etc. shall comply with the following rules for obtaining building permit:—

(i) Maximum Ground Coverage - 40%

(ii) FAR for road access of 9 meters, 10 meters and above 17 meters shall 1.5, 2.5 and 4.0 respectively;

(iii) Statutory open Spaces— (Open spaces around the building) For building below 18 m height Provisions of the rule 50 may be followed, For building above 18 m height all around set back of 6 m to be increased by 1 m for every 3 m height increase.

Provided that a "No objection" certificate shall be produced from the authorities as indicated below for constfuction of office or hospital on any plot of 4 K or above:—

(a) the West Bengal Fire Services Directorate,

(b) the Director of Factories or Industries, Government of West Bengal,

(c) the West Bengal Pollution Control Board,

(d) the West Bengal State Electricity Board, and

(e) the Public Health Engineering Directorate, Government of West Bengal.
